#6ddec3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6ddec3 is composed of 42.7% red, 87.1% green and 76.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 12.2%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 165.7 degrees, a saturation of 63.1% and a lightness of 64.9%. #6ddec3 color hex could be obtained by blending #daffff with #00bd87.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#6ddec3 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#6ddec3 has RGB values of R:109, G:222, B:195 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0, Y:0.12,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 7200451.

Shades and Tints of #6ddec3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030e0b is the darkest color, while #fdfff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6ddec3

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a4a7a6 is the less saturated color, while #51fad1 is the most saturated one.
